// GARAGE_FEED_POLL_MS controls how often the Stallport occupancy
// feed is polled. Plugin authors: do not set this below 5000 —
// the Veldgate aggregator rate-limits aggressively and your plugin
// will be quarantined. Stale counts older than two polls are
// dropped, not interpolated. If your occupancy widget shows gaps,
// check the feed epoch first. Compatibility is pinned to the
// trace token below.

trace token, fafof-tajef: htk9_849b0fd88

/*
 * WATCHDOG_HEARTBEAT_INTERVAL_MS
 *
 * The Foyerlight kiosk watchdog expects a heartbeat within this
 * interval; missing two consecutive beats triggers a soft restart
 * of the renderer process. Chosen conservatively after the Dettmar
 * lobby freeze incident. Any change must be validated on hardware
 * first. Verified on build:
 */

session token of tajef-bageg = htk21_5d90d574934f3ccae6437

Subject: Transcode farm — new owner

Support team: effective Monday, I'm off the Kestrelworks transcoding farm. Escalation path is unchanged — page the media-infra rotation first. Stuck jobs, codec errors, and capacity questions go to the new owner, not me. Runbooks are current as of last week. The person now responsible is listed below.

named custodian: Brivan Eliath Quenox Frador